I bought it for my almost three year old boy in size 2T. He's not a big kid; pretty average in size but wanted it to fit well and read the reviews it was big. We've had it for several months now. He is now 3 years old, 32 pounds. The pants are a bit large, but have belt loops. The shirt is a bit thin but looks cool under the jacket. The tie has a clasp, of course, so don't accidentally put it in the wash, otherwise you'll have to look around for a new one. We bought this for our little man because he needed a suit to be the conductor on the Polar Express. He's a pretty well-dressed kid, so it made sense to just buy him a full suit. I'll put it this way: He wears a jacket 3-4 times a week: to school, to the playground, even sleeps in it. Of course the pants are a bit loose and he usually wears many other ties/shirts but I can't think of a single complaint other than the pockets are fake. If your three-year-old wears a pocket watch, their jacket and waistcoat won't match. But it washes well. I throw him in the regular laundry and dry him with the rest of his three year old dirty clothes. It looks so cool and complements everywhere. If you are looking for a suit for an elegant little boy, this is a great option.
